来源:黑桃K手游网 更新:2024-05-23 00:00:24
用手机看
在我使用SQLServer的过程中,经常会遇到需要将字符串转换为数字的情况。这个过程虽然看似简单,但却让我感受到了其中的乐趣和挑战。在SQLServer中,我们可以使用CAST或CONVERT函数来实现这一转换,而我更倾向于使用CONVERT函数,因为它相对更加灵活。
我发现,在进行字符串转数字的时候,需要考虑到字符串的格式是否符合数字类型的要求,比如是否包含字母、特殊符号等。如果字符串中包含了无法转换为数字的字符,转换过程就会失败,这时候就需要进行数据清洗或者异常处理,确保数据的准确性。
另外,我还发现在进行字符串转数字的过程中,可以通过指定第二个参数来控制转换后的数字格式。比如可以指定转换后的数字是整数、小数,甚至是货币类型,这样可以更好地满足不同场景下的需求。
在实际应用中,我还遇到了一些有趣的情况,比如在处理用户输入时,需要对输入的内容进行验证和转换。有时候用户会输入一些奇怪的字符,比如空格、制表符等,这时候就需要对输入内容进行清洗,只提取出其中的数字部分进行转换,确保转换的准确性。
总的来说,虽然字符串转数字这个过程可能会让人头疼,但是在不断的实践和尝试中,我逐渐掌握了其中的技巧和方法,也更加熟练地应用于实际项目中。这个过程让我对SQLServer有了更深。